Transaction 2f99f092aef7b945c824ed677c96649b8fb63bc4626f27b3ea21a32dedbc5696

1 Input
1 Outputs
  • 2f99f092aef7b945c824ed677c96649b8fb63bc4626f27b3ea21a32dedbc5696:0
  • value  590477
    address  3JU9u3QRwPCXVWZZ5zixxbcJgEagYixvj3